Early Adopters Pick: November 2002. The worlds smallest, lightest 3.2-megapixel camera, with a revolutionary folded 3x optical zoom lens.
By incorporating a clever internal zoom lens, developing a slim new rechargeable battery, and using diminutive SD memory cards, Minolta's Dimage Xi is truly pocket-sized. The Dimage Xi features a 3.2-megapixel CCD sensor--an improvement over the 2-megapixel Dimage X--and a 3x optical zoom. Besides increased resolution, the Dimage Xi has several other enhancements, including selectable ISO settings, optional date imprinting, spot autofocus (AF), an improved antireflection LCD, and automatic e-mail file copy creation.
Optics and Resolution
The Dimage Xi has a 3-megapixel sensor with a maximum resolution of 2,048 x 1,536 pixels, enough detail for photos from 4 by 6 inches to 11 by 14 inches. It also features a 3x optical zoom (equivalent to a 37-111mm on a 35mm camera) and a 4x digital zoom for a total 12x zoom.
This lens employs five aspheric elements (including two double-sided) to ensure sharp, contrast-rich images at all focal lengths. In spite of its compact dimensions, the optical zoom has a fast, maximum aperture of f2.8-f3.6 (wide to telephoto), which allows images to be captured in low light with little noise.
Storage and Transfer
Images are stored on stamp-size Secure Digital (SD) or MultiMediaCard memory cards. The Dimage Xi comes with a 16 MB SD card. Images can be transferred to your Mac or PC via USB, and the included audio-visual cable lets you view images and film clips on your home TV.
Movie Mode
In movie mode, the Dimage Xi captures 320 x 240 pixel video (with audio) for up to 35 seconds at 15 frames per second. The QuickTime Motion JPEG format offers a limited resolution, which is great for capturing a short movie that can be e-mailed to friends and family.
More Features
The Dimage Xi's most unusual feature is its internal zoom lens. While most digital cameras are built like their film counterparts--with a telescoping zoom lens protruding from the front--the lens assembly in the Dimage Xi is arranged vertically inside the camera, with the sensor at the very bottom, like a periscope in a submarine. This layout allows for a slim camera with a full 3x optical zoom. In addition, startup times are faster, since you don't have to wait for the lens to extend before shooting.
Other features include:
- Audio caption recording of up to 15 seconds
- 1.5-inch TFT LCD screen
- Flash modes: auto, red-eye reduction, night portrait
Power, Size, and Contents
The camera is powered by a rechargeable lithium-ion battery NP-200 (included). It measures 3.3 by 2.8 by 0.8 inches and weighs 4.6 ounces. This package includes the Dimage Xi digital camera, battery and battery charger, USB and AV cables, hand strap, and Dimage software and viewer CD-ROM and USB drivers for Windows and Mac.
The DiMAGE Xi is one of the worlds smallest, lightest, and thinnest digital camera with a 3.3 megapixel CCD (3.2 million effective pixels). It houses a revolutionary folded 12X (3X optical) zoom lens that can capture everything from scenic landscapes to intimate portraits. The lens is positioned vertically within the camera, which allows the lens to always remain inside the camera body. While maintaining one of the worlds fastest start-up (1.2 seconds) and response time, the DiMAGE Xi offers enhanced features which makes it a fun and easy-to-use, versatile multimedia tool.
Enhanced features include; 12X zoom capability (3X Optical, 4X Digital), Macro Capability, user-selectable ISO settings, optional date imprinting, spot autofocus (AF), an anti-reflection LCD, an automatic e-mail file copy creation function, and the user can make movie clips and add audio to their still images.
Folded 3X Optical Zoom Lens
Although the DiMAGE Xi is thinner than any single focal length digital camera, it houses a revolutionary folded 3X optical zoom lens that can capture everything from scenic landscapes to intimate portraits. By using a high-quality prism that folds the optical path, the lens never extends from the camera body, and zooming noise is reduced to a whisper. This exclusive f/2.8 3.6 lens provides a 5.7 17.1mm focal range (equivalent to 37 111mm on a 35mm camera). The high-performance lens optics include five aspheric elements to ensure crisp, detailed images with high contrast.
12x Seamless Zoom (3X Optical, 4X Digital)
In addition to the 3X optical zoom, the DiMAGE Xi provides 2X and 4X digital zoom power, selectable in 0.2X increments. The resulting maximum 12X zoom capacity equals a 444mm lens on a 35mm camera.
Fine Image Quality
The little DiMAGE Xi is big on performance. Images captured with the super-sharp aspheric zoom lens are formed with 3.2 million effective pixels, and enhanced by Minoltas CxProcess image processing technology the same technology used in Minoltas top-of-the-line DiMAGE 7Hi digital SLR camera. The CCDs pixel resolution will produce 10 X 14 inch (B4 size) 150 dpi prints or double-L size photo-quality prints.
Wide and Spot Autofocus Modes
Two autofocus modes give precise control over image sharpness. Wide AF uses a large autofocus area for quick, easy picture-taking. Spot AF uses a small focus area in the center of the image for singling out a specific subject or detail.
CxProcess Image Processing
Minoltas CxProcess image processing technology produces vivid digital images that mirror your original impression of the scene. CxProcess produces clear, natural-looking images by optimizing sharpness, color, and contrast, while minimizing noise.
Macro Capability
Taking beautifully detailed close-ups is a snap with the DiMAGE Xi. It can make sharp, clear images of objects as close as 9.8 inches from the camera face, without the need for special macro settings. At the telephoto position, an area the size of a business card can be covered.
Movie and Audio Recording
Besides being one of the worlds smallest digital cameras, the DiMAGE Xi is a versatile multimedia tool with movie and audio functions. Up to 35 seconds of digital video can be recorded with accompanying audio. You can also record a 15-second voice memo immediately after capturing a still image, or attach up to 15 seconds of audio to a previously recorded still image. Plus, up to 30 minutes of audio without image data can be recorded.
E-Mail Copy Function
Sending e-mail images was never this simple. The DiMAGE Xis e-mail copy function makes a 640 X 480 (VGA) copy of an image on the memory card so that it can be easily transferred over the Internet.
Auto Reset Function
The auto reset function gives photographers the choice of having user-selected mode settings remain active or reset to "full auto" when the camera is switched off. For casual users, this prevents previous settings from being accidentally employed the next time the camera is used. For advanced image-makers, the specific camera functions can be set and remain set for each use.
LCD Monitor plus Optical Viewfinder
For optimum versatility and easy image making even on bright sunny days, the DiMAGE Xi features an LCD monitor plus an optical real-image viewfinder.

Uses SD Memory Cards or MultiMediaCards
The DiMAGE Xi uses the popular SD Memory Cards or MultiMediaCards as recording media. These tiny cards, about the size of a commemorative stamp, are widely available.
Easy Data Transfer to PC
When the DiMAGE Xi is turned on, in record or playback mode, images and other data can be transferred to a personal computer through the supplied USB cable. Plug in the cable and simply drag and drop the images onto the computer.
Bundled with DiMAGE Viewer
DiMAGE Viewer supports the latest generation of Minolta digital cameras. The Viewer complements the camera by allowing still and movie images to be processed and edited on a computer. A wide range of image-processing controls is available, plus a new movie enhancer plug-in for editing and processing digital video. The DiMAGE Viewer is not limited to images captured with Minolta cameras, and can edit and process numerous common image-file formats.
